Next up was Boccia which is a bit like Bowls crossed with the French game Petanque but you play with a mini football that's soft so it doesn't bounce.

This is our Boccia instructor Dave Smith. He was world number one at Boccia so we had the best teacher. He is a dude.

John Sicolo was a dude. He ran a club in Newport called TJs. It use to be called Sico's and many still called it by that name. We use to go there as young kids growing up in the Port, we even put on a night back in the early 90s, playing the records we liked.
All the bands that you can ever imagine played at TJs from Oasis to P.W.E.I. to my sister and her weird student mates.
Anyway, the leader, John sicolo, pasted on not so long ago and to celebrate his life and to kind of thank him (a bit late really) for all the music and that, it was decided that there should be a massive party in Newport's John Frost Square.
